Application

Rivi Magnetics magnetic clamping systems M-TECS P are primarily used for automatic clamping of different moulds on injection moulding machines.

 

Description

With Rivi Magnetics magnetic clamping systems, the moulds are magnetically clamped or unclamped at the touch of a button within a few seconds.
Since permanent magnets generate the force of the magnetic clamping plates, electric clamping is only required to magnetize the plates.
The magnetic clamping plates are de-energized in clamped condition and thus absolutely safe in case of power failure. The complete clamping cycle is monitored by different sensors, thus guaranteeing reliable mould clamping.
All Rivi Magnetics magnetic clamping systems carry the CE mark.

 

Advantages

  • Standardization of moulds no longer required
  • High safety by process monitoring
  • Clamping of the moulds within a few seconds
  • Ergonomic handling with ease
  • Mould clamping also in the heated condition
  • No further mounting holes required
  • Minimum wear of the moulds
  • Motion detection of the mould
  • Mould clamping on the complete surface with minimum deformation

M-TECS square poles for extremely heavy machining

Each magnetic plate can be individually adapted to the particular machine table. Exact positioning on the machine table is ensured using 20H7 longitudinal and crosswise slots. The fixation is made in an all around clamping groove by means of clamping claws. Combinations with Hilma machine vices or Stark zero point clamping systems can be easily realised, as they all come from a single supplier. Additional T-slots, mounting holes, stops and special dimensions are not a problem to us.
